Oxamyl (Vydate)
Natchitoches Water System
Oxamyl is a neurotoxic insecticide used on cotton, fruit and vegetable crops. It may harm fetal development.

State, National, and Health Guidelines for Drinking Water
EWG Health Guideline: 26 ppb
The EWG Health Guideline of 26 ppb for oxamyl was defined by the California Office of Environmental Health Hazard Assessment as a public health goal, the level of a drinking water contaminant that does not pose a significant health risk. This health guideline protects against harm to the central nervous system.
EPA Maximum Contaminant
Level (MCL): 200 ppb
The legal limit for oxamyl, established in 1992, was based on a toxicity study in laboratory animals conducted in the 1980s.
